Varekai: Cirque Du Soleil at the Wolstien Center is a fantasy rendition of the Greek myth of Icarus. Icarus was the son of a master craftsman, who constructed him wing of feathers and wax. One day Icarus flies to close to the sun and his wings melt and he fall to earth. In Varekai, when Icarus falls he lands in a whole new world. Icarus explores Varekai and all the amazing new creatures inside this world. Watch as he learns, grows and falls in love.

Rich Color

The makeup in Cirque Du Soleil’s shows are amazing. Each performer does their own makeup and it’s stunning. It take some of them 90 minuets just to complete their makeup.
